11x-2(3-2x)=5(x-4)-6
We move all terms to the left:
11x-2(3-2x)-(5(x-4)-6)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
11x-2(-2x+3)-(5(x-4)-6)=0
We multiply parentheses
11x+4x-(5(x-4)-6)-6=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(5(x-4)-6), so:We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
5(x-4)-6
We multiply parentheses
5x-20-6
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
5x-26
Back to the equation:
-(5x-26)
15x-(5x-26)-6=0
We get rid of parentheses
15x-5x+26-6=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
10x+20=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
10x=-20
x=-20/10
x=-2
